A
Russian-English Collocational Dictionary of the Human Body
For Windows and Macintosh
"Blow your nose!" "Wash your hair!" "Chava has pretty brown eyes!"
If you want to use these phrases in Russian, the usual bilingual dictionary
won't help: there may be over 30 definitions for the word "blow," and if
you look up "hair," you're on the wrong track.
This dictionary is a complete inventory of expressions for describing
the body, moods, emotions, movements, illnesses, and more. The word for
"eye" alone has over 500 expressions, with many examples.
The
Russian Dictionary Tree
Under Windows NT 4, 2000, and XP, the RDT must be used in conjunction
with Cyrillic Support 2000. Under Windows 95, 98, and ME,
the RDT does not require Cyrillic Support.
This 12,000-entry dictionary allows you to search for a Russian or
English word, and displays all the forms and all the endings for every
entry. Unlike many electronic dictionaries, it is not an abridged version
of a printed reference book. On the contrary, definitions are far more detailed,
and many entries contain examples and extensive notes on style and usage.

Cyrillic
Support 2000
For Windows
Cyrillic Support 2000 has everything you need for using Cyrillic-based
languages in Windows: keyboard drivers, a wide selection of Cyrillic
TrueType fonts, Cyrillic system fonts, and a program to convert Cyrillic
texts between all popular DOS, Internet, Macintosh, and Windows encoding
schemes.
All modern Slavic languages which use a Cyrillic alphabet are
supported: Belarusian, Bulgarian, Macedonian, Russian, Serbian, and
Ukrainian. Accented Russian vowels are available for marking stress.
Published by Fingertip Software.
